Need help!

I have a 2K3 EXT fishy and the flush cocking thing has gone a little haywire.

I basically put in a bolt that didn't comply with the "flush cocking" system on the EXT. However, the bolt to me is worth more than the convience of the flush cocking system, so I'm looking to replace the part. Will any Fishy bolt system work, or is the whole thing screwed up?

Just a warning, the backblock WILL NOT fit a standard cocking pin, so if this happens to you, DO NOT just buy a new cocking pin. I got a call into PMI to figure out this mess.

It actually only ended up being a 7 dollar fix, just need a standard rear block versus the flush cocking one. So no harm, no foul.
